Understanding Early-Onset Dementia
Early-onset dementia, or young-onset dementia (YOD), is diagnosed before age 65. Unlike late-onset dementia, which is more commonly associated with older age, YOD affects individuals during their peak working and family-raising years. This timing creates distinct challenges, including potential delays in diagnosis, significant financial and career impacts, and unique family dynamics. Global Prevalence and Incidence of Young-Onset Dementia
Recent studies offer a clearer picture of YOD prevalence. A 2021 systematic review and meta-analysis estimated the global age-standardized prevalence of YOD at 119.0 per 100,000 people aged 30 to 64. This indicates that approximately 3.9 million people worldwide are living with YOD. The prevalence increases with age within this demographic, rising from a low in the 30-34 age group to a significantly higher rate in the 60-64 age group. In terms of new cases, a 2022 meta-analysis estimated a global incidence of about 11 new cases per 100,000 person-years for individuals aged 30-64, totaling around 370,000 new cases annually. Regional variations in incidence exist, possibly reflecting differences in diagnostic practices and healthcare access.
Comparing Early-Onset and Late-Onset Dementia
Understanding the differences between early and late-onset dementia is crucial:
| Feature | Early-Onset Dementia (YOD) | Late-Onset Dementia (LOD) |
|---|---|---|
| Age of Onset | Typically before age 65 | Typically after age 65 |
| Prevalence | Less common overall, but a significant global health challenge. | Far more common. |
| Common Cause | Alzheimer's is most common, but other types like frontotemporal dementia are relatively more frequent than in LOD. | Alzheimer's disease is most common, followed by vascular dementia. |
| Progression Speed | Often reported to be faster and involve more extensive neurological damage. | Varies, but often slower than YOD. |
| Initial Symptoms | Can include memory loss, behavioral changes, language issues, and motor deficits. | Often focuses on memory loss and cognitive impairment. |
| Diagnostic Challenges | Higher risk of misdiagnosis due to rarity in younger individuals. | More readily recognized, though diagnosis is still complex. |
Factors Influencing the Rise of Early Dementia
The observed increase in early dementia diagnoses is likely due to several contributing factors:
- Improved Diagnosis: Advances in medical imaging, neuropsychological testing, and biomarker analysis allow for earlier and more accurate identification of dementia types.
- Population Demographics: Global population growth, particularly in regions with improving healthcare, leads to a greater number of individuals potentially affected by YOD.
- Risk Factor Landscape: While some risk factors like high blood pressure are better managed in certain populations, others, such as high body mass index and alcohol use disorder, remain concerning.
Causes and Risk Factors for Early Dementia
A combination of genetic and lifestyle factors contribute to early-onset dementia. The types of dementia seen in YOD can differ in their distribution compared to LOD.
Genetic Influences
- Familial Alzheimer's Disease: A rare, inherited form linked to specific gene mutations (APP, PSEN1, PSEN2), causing symptoms to appear as early as a person's 30s.
- APOE Gene: The APOE ε4 variant increases Alzheimer's risk, potentially having a greater impact on women in midlife.
Modifiable Lifestyle Factors
- Alcohol Use Disorder: Significantly increases the risk of YOD.
- Cardiovascular Health: Conditions like high blood pressure, heart disease, and stroke are notable risk factors.
- Diabetes: Especially impactful for men, diabetes is a recognized risk factor.
- Social Isolation: A strong link exists between social isolation and increased YOD risk.
- Mental Health: Depression is associated with a substantially increased risk and is considered a treatable factor.
- Vitamin D Deficiency: Research suggests a connection between low vitamin D levels and a higher risk of YOD.
Addressing Early-Onset Dementia
Effectively addressing the challenges of YOD requires a comprehensive approach:
- Enhancing Diagnosis: Training healthcare professionals to recognize YOD symptoms and improving access to advanced diagnostic tools are vital to reduce diagnostic delays, which are often longer for YOD than LOD.
- Providing Tailored Support: Support services should cater to the specific needs of individuals and families affected by YOD during their working years, addressing financial, career, and family-related issues.
- Promoting Risk Factor Management: Public health initiatives can educate the public on modifiable risk factors and encourage healthy lifestyle choices, as highlighted by experts like Dr. Andrew Budson.
- Supporting Research: Continued research, particularly in understudied populations and age groups, is essential to deepen understanding, develop better treatments, and improve prevention strategies.
